Is Chandler or Virginia Beach Safer?
According to crimebycity.com's analysis of 2024 FBI data, Chandler is safer than Virginia Beach (Safety Score 52/100 vs 48/100), with a total crime rate of 1,638 per 100,000 versus 1,733 for Virginia Beach — 6% lower. Chandler has lower rates in 5 of 7 crime categories.
The biggest difference is in murder, where Chandler has a 75% lower rate.

Detailed Crime Rate Comparison
| Crime Type | Chandler | Virginia Beach |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Total Crime Rate | 1,637.8 | 1,733.3 | -95.5 |
| Violent Crime Rate | 133.4 | 93.4 | +40.0 |
| Murder Rate | 0.7 | 2.9 | -2.2 |
| Rape Rate | 17.4 | 18.5 | -1.0 |
| Robbery Rate | 23.5 | 31.6 | -8.2 |
| Aggravated Assault Rate | 91.8 | 39.3 | +52.5 |
| Property Crime Rate | 1,504.4 | 1,639.9 | -135.5 |
| Burglary Rate | 120.6 | 83.9 | +36.7 |
| Larceny-Theft Rate | 1,292.3 | 1,446.8 | -154.4 |
| Motor Vehicle Theft Rate | 91.4 | 109.2 | -17.8 |
All rates per 100,000 residents. Source: FBI UCR 2024.

About Chandler, AZ
Chandler, Arizona, a desert community southeast of Phoenix, was founded by veterinarian Dr. A. J. Chandler. Now a city with a significant tech industry, it boasts a diverse population exceeding 275,000. With a safety score of 52/100 and a population coverage of 281,117, Chandler has a total crime rate of 1,637.8 per 100,000 residents.
About Virginia Beach, VA
Virginia Beach, a coastal city where the Chesapeake Bay meets the Atlantic, is home to the Naval Air Station Oceana, a major employer. Its population of nearly half a million is diverse, with significant military and retiree communities. With a safety score of 48/100 and a population coverage of 455,155, Virginia Beach has a total crime rate of 1,733.3 per 100,000 residents.
